Describe the bug
Installing a mod that isn't supported for the current version of the game shows a pop-up warning about the mod not being up-to-date. The button to confirm installation is incorrectly translated into "Rozmiar instalacji" which translates to "installation size". The correct translation should be "Zainstaluj" which translates into "Install".

If you install a mod, in the Changeset a couple of translation mistakes appear. The "Change" column is in the wrong grammatical form (should be "Zmiana") and the "Install" change in that column is incorrectly translated into "Rozmiar instalacji" ("Installation size")
Steps to reproduce
- Set CKAN language to "pl-PL"
- Attempt to install a mod that does not support the current version of the game
- Notice the wrong translation in the pop-up
- Approve the mod for installation
- Notice the wrong translation in the Changeset tab
